Transaction acdc55c9bc5ae305520c729c78e9251d5d290c893f53d4089340bfd6f0e25e24
1 Input
1 Output
-
acdc55c9bc5ae305520c729c78e9251d5d290c893f53d4089340bfd6f0e25e24:0
- value
- 26043608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d7dea78daa34c024ea7055c0f177d6fd0924c0d OP_EQUAL
- address
- 37J9z33GwHHhkFswhdxNpc7ZzKpgpKAfCe